thumb|Dinotherium gigantissimum Ștef. The skeleton was found in 1966 near Pripiceni village. The first description of this animal was made by the scientist Grigoriu Ștefănescu (1836-1911).

Pripiceni-Răzeși is a commune in Rezina District, Moldova. It is composed of two villages, Pripiceni-Curchi and Pripiceni-Răzeși.
